As an Enterprise Sales customer, we should be able to set custom goals. I love that we can set goals for number of calls made, deals created or revenue but I'd also like to set goals for individual users based on Number of Deals Closed by Pipeline and (more importantly for us) Deals with a Deal Stage Modified This Month. We want to be able to show how our Sales associates are progressing their customers through the sales process. This will help us better understand at what point of the sales process do our Sales associates need specific training. If they have had 20 deals progress to Step 3 of the process and only 8 progress to Step 4 then we know that we can focus training efforts on how to get customers to a Step 4. Setting goals around this would be helpful if only on a cumualitive basis.
